Abstract

This paper addresses the application of ICA to digital image processing. First of all, it is shown that edge detection can be obtained by reconstructing an image from its dominant ICA features. Using this result, an ICA-based watermarking method is proposed. Simulations show that the watermarks are robust against compression and gaussian noise.
